I thought this was just okay until someone suggested I apply it with a concealer brush. What a difference that made. I was able to pat it on my undereye area and make it look more natural. Also, using the brush makes the area less slippery since my fingers aren't messing with things. I use it on my eyelids and it really holds my powder eye shadow on pretty well. Like other reviewers have said, it's staying power isn't the greatest so that takes it down a notch or two in my rating.

I have that annyoing skin that is dry yet acne-prone. Moisturizing foundations clog my pores and aggravate my acne. Anti-acne foundations dry out my skin something awful. So this is an AWESOME foundation to even out my skin (I use a little extra in my red areas) and not dry my skin. It looks natural and feels great. A little dab goes a long way.
